Common Misconceptions About VPNs and Anonymity

Despite their widespread use, many users misunderstand the capabilities of a VPN anonymous purchase. One common myth is that a VPN guarantees complete anonymity. While it significantly enhances privacy, it is not a foolproof solution.

Debunking Myths About VPNs

  • Myth: A VPN Makes You Completely Anonymous: While a VPN anonymous purchase hides your IP address, it does not protect against other tracking methods, such as browser fingerprinting or metadata analysis.
  • Myth: All VPNs Are Equal: The effectiveness of a VPN anonymous purchase depends on the provider’s infrastructure, encryption standards, and logging policies.

To maximize the benefits of a VPN anonymous purchase, users must pair it with additional privacy tools, such as Tor or encrypted messaging apps, and avoid sharing personal information online.
